Output 31530a9d9339c1506e7e9318b5f7e4edf413a5091f57cb1eab5358d18d166807:1

value
520210
script pubkey
OP_0 OP_PUSHBYTES_20 31a8fee9b4a55c89e79c6bdd61ff75695c8c5b25
address
bc1qxx50a6d554wgneuud0wkrlm4d9wgcke9lwndx7
transaction
31530a9d9339c1506e7e9318b5f7e4edf413a5091f57cb1eab5358d18d166807
confirmations
55433
spent
true